The following Confederate States Army units and commanders fought in the Battle of New Market in the American Civil War. The Union order of battle is shown separately.

Department of Western Virginia[]

MG John C. Breckinridge, commanding

Division Brigade Regiments and Others

Infantry Division

1st Brigade


   BG John Echols

  • 22nd Virginia: Col George S. Patton
  • 23rd Virginia Battalion: Ltc Clarence Derrick
  • 26th Virginia Battalion: Ltc George M. Edgar
2nd Brigade


   BG Gabriel C. Wharton

Unattached

Attached commands
  • Hart's Engineer Company:[2] Cpt William T. Hart
  • Augusta-Rockingham Reserves: Col William Harman
  • Davis' Company Maryland Cavalry:[2] Cpt T. Sturgis Davis
  • V.M.I. Cadets: Ltc Scott Ship
Cavalry


   BG John D. Imboden

  • 18th Virginia: Col George W. Imboden
  • 23rd Virginia:[3] Col Robert White
  • 43rd Virginia Battalion Partisans: Ltc John S. Mosby
  • 2nd Maryland Battalion: Maj Harry W. Gilmor
  • McNeill's Company, Partisans: Cpt John H. McNeill
Artillery


   Maj William McLaughlin

  • Chapman’s (Virginia) Battery: Cpt George B. Chapman
  • Jackson’s (Virginia) Battery: 1st Lt Randolph H. Blain
  • McClanahan’s (Virginia) Battery: Cpt John McClanahan
  • V.M.I section: Cadet Cpt C. H. Minge
